Globeflex Capital L P Takes Position in Digital Turbine, Inc. $APPS

Globeflex Capital L P acquired a new stake in Digital Turbine, Inc. (NASDAQ:APPSFree Report) during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m acquired 367,860 shares of the software maker’s stock, valued at approximately $4,745,000. Globeflex Capital L P owned about 0.30% of Digital Turbine at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Digital Turbine Stock Performance

Digital Turbine stock opened at $10.87 on Monday. The business has a 50 day moving average of $10.52 and a 200-day moving average of $6.63. The company has a market capitalization of $1.32 billion, a P/E ratio of -41.81, a P/E/G ratio of 0.46 and a beta of 2.81. Digital Turbine, Inc. has a 1 year low of $2.74 and a 1 year high of $15.34.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.80, a current ratio of 1.20 and a quick ratio of 1.20.

Digital Turbine (NASDAQ:APPSG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, August 4th. The software maker reported $0.19 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.14 by $0.05. Digital Turbine had a negative net margin of 4.46% and a positive return on equity of 38.34%. The business had revenue of $165.98 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$149.98 million. On average, equities research analysts predict that Digital Turbine, Inc. will post 0.75 earnings per share for the current year.

Digital Turbine Company Profile

(Free Report)

Digital Turbine, Inc (NASDAQ: APPS) is a mobile technology company that streamlines content delivery and app advertising across connected devices. Its platform enables carriers, OEMs, app developers and advertisers to engage users through personalized app recommendations, in-app promotions and turnkey monetization solutions. By integrating software directly on smartphones and tablets, Digital Turbine simplifies the user journey from discovery to installation without requiring additional downloads or redirects through traditional app stores.

The company’s flagship Ignite Platform offers end-to-end campaign management, combining demand-side advertising, real-time analytics and automated content fulfillment.
